Wet your fingers with water to help seal the dough edges. If the dough tears, pinch gently to patch it. Chill the aspic thoroughly for a perfect jelly that melts during steaming to create the soup inside. Avoid lifting the steamer lid too often to keep steam consistent. For gluten-free dough, use a rice flour and tapioca starch blend with xanthan gum. Leftovers can be refrigerated for up to 2 days and reheated by steaming or pan-frying gently.
